Claudia Winkleman’s Fingerless Gloves: A Winter Fashion Staple
As the new season of “The Traitors” kicks off, Claudia Winkleman’s wardrobe is making a bold return, showcasing her signature highland gothic style. Styled by Sinead McKeefry, Claudia has been flaunting various looks, featuring chunky boots, oversized knits, and wool coats, with one constant accessory – her fingerless gloves.
Since the inception of “The Traitors,” Claudia has sported Brora’s Women’s Cashmere Wristwarmers in an array of colors, earning praise from fans for her iconic outfits. These wristwarmers, priced at £65, have become a coveted item for those seeking both style and comfort.
Crafted from four-ply 100% Scottish cashmere at a historic textile mill in Scotland, these wristwarmers offer unparalleled softness and warmth without any itchiness. Available in 10 different hues, including Claudia’s favorites like black and conker shades, these gloves feature a thumb slot, leaving fingers exposed while keeping them cozy for winter activities.
For budget-conscious shoppers, House of Bruar offers Gauzy Cashmere Fingerless Mitts at £37.95 in 18 colors, mirroring Claudia’s style. Alternatively, Johnston’s of Elgin has discounted Women’s Fingerless Light Green Cashmere Gloves from £85 to £45, featuring individual finger slots for added warmth. For extra coverage, Toast’s Nishiguchi Kutsushita Merino Tipless Gloves at £30 reach up the forearm, crafted from merino wool in Japan.
